Transaction 72513d08008bed1021760b63e5023095256d8fee011a8d0a50aeb07058b819da

1 Input
2 Outputs
  • 72513d08008bed1021760b63e5023095256d8fee011a8d0a50aeb07058b819da:0
  • value  6869000
    address  1EYAufn5kgcDrmHBXBKhANAkvF8KsWeiC4
  • 72513d08008bed1021760b63e5023095256d8fee011a8d0a50aeb07058b819da:1
  • value  869010835
    address  3Jo1X8T5b8ZNT36LAabiqsn12SuXsgM7Qd